Marinate the chicken: In a bowl, mix diced chicken with sliced red onion, 2 tablespoons mayonnaise, and Montreal Chicken Seasoning. Cover and refrigerate for at least 4 hours.
Preheat the griddle to medium heat. 400 degrees
Cook the bacon until about halfway done. Push to one side of the griddle.
Add the marinated chicken and onions to the griddle next to the bacon. Cook for about 4 minutes, then flip and cook another 4 minutes, or until the chicken reaches 165°F.
Toss in the bacon to combine with the chicken and onions.
Pour BBQ sauce over the mixture and toss a few times to coat evenly.
Top with slices of Gouda cheese and cover with a dome to melt.
Place buns cut-side down directly on top of the cheesy chicken mixture. Once the cheese is melted, put your bun on top and slide a spatula underneath to flip (cheesesteak style).
Slice, serve, and enjoy hot off the griddle!
